Dr. Chris Akins, MD is a cardiothoracic surgeon in Petoskey, MI and has over 35 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Alabama at Birmingham in 1989. He is affiliated with medical facilities McLaren Northern Michigan and Otsego Memorial Hospital. He is accepting new patients.
